Under One Sky
Uniting Church, Port Macquarie
Sunday, 30th March 2014

Hastings Choristers has a tradition of participating in exciting musical ventures with Australian composers visiting Port Macquarie to conduct their cutting edge compositions. A virtual newcomer to our area, Harley Mead is a well-known young Australian composer who is Head of Performance at Towoomba Grammar School, and a much sought-after composer of accessible choral and instrumental music.

Harley composed a new work for SATB chorus, commissioned by Sydney Grammar Schools’ Preparatory campuses at St Ives and Edgecliff, which was premiered in this concert by the Edgecliff and St Ives campus choirs, Tacking Point Public School’s Bel Canto and our own Cantorus. It has the theme of multicultural Australia - people fleeing their homelands to make their home here UNDER ONE SKY, presented through choral and instrumental music.
